The Mettler Toledo Sevengo Conductivity Adapter 51302329 is a specialized accessory designed to work with Mettler Toledo’s Sevengo conductivity electrodes. It functions as a crucial intermediary, facilitating accurate and reliable conductivity measurements. The core function is to measure the electrical conductivity of water, which directly correlates to the concentration of dissolved ions present in the water.

This measurement is achieved by quantifying how much electricity flows through a material. For instance, it can quantify the ionic load in water, highlighting the presence of dissolved salts, minerals, and other conductive substances. The adapter is instrumental in translating the raw ionic flux into a measurable electrical signal.

It’s important to note that the adapter is designed to work in conjunction with a specific conductivity electrode and a compatible Mettler Toledo meter. Therefore, its specifications are intrinsically linked to the performance characteristics of the overall measurement system. The precise cell constant and temperature compensation capabilities are determined by the electrode it’s paired with, but the adapter ensures these are accurately relayed and processed.

Who Should Buy Mettler Toledo Sevengo Conductivity Adapter 51302329?

This adapter is specifically designed for professionals and researchers who require highly accurate and continuous conductivity monitoring. It is perfect for industrial water treatment facilities, where maintaining water quality for processes like boiler feed, reverse osmosis, or wastewater treatment is critical. Laboratories involved in environmental science, chemistry, and materials research will also find it indispensable for precise analysis.

Furthermore, food and beverage manufacturers that rely on specific water purity levels for product consistency and safety would benefit greatly. Anyone involved in semiconductor manufacturing or pharmaceutical production, where even minute impurities in water can have significant consequences, should consider this adapter as part of their quality control instrumentation.

Who should skip this product? Casual users or hobbyists who only require occasional or approximate conductivity readings should look at less specialized and less expensive consumer-grade conductivity meters. Individuals not operating within an established Mettler Toledo measurement system or without the need for continuous, high-precision data would also find this product overkill and unnecessarily expensive.

Must-have accessories or modifications? The most crucial “accessory” is a compatible Mettler Toledo Sevengo conductivity electrode and a Mettler Toledo conductivity meter. Without these, the adapter is non-functional. Depending on the application, users might also need specialized sample cells or flow-through setups to integrate the electrode and adapter effectively into their process.
